PPT重复播放怎么设置?如何自动循环播放?
作者:佚名|分类:PPT教程|浏览:59|发布时间:2025-02-12 00:02:41
随着信息技术的不断发展,PPT(PowerPoint)已成为我们日常生活中不可或缺的演示工具。然而,在实际应用中,我们可能会遇到PPT重复播放或自动循环播放的需求。本文将详细讲解PPT重复播放的设置方法以及如何实现自动循环播放,帮助您轻松应对各种演示场景。
一、PPT重复播放设置方法
1. 使用幻灯片放映视图
(1)打开PPT文件,点击“幻灯片放映”选项卡。
(2)在“设置放映方式”组中,点击“设置放映方式”。
(3)在弹出的“设置放映方式”对话框中,勾选“循环放映,按Esc键终止”选项。
(4)点击“确定”按钮,完成设置。
2. 使用快捷键
(1)打开PPT文件,按“F5”键进入幻灯片放映视图。
(2)按“Ctrl+H”组合键,打开“查找和替换”对话框。
(3)在“查找内容”框中输入“[EndOfPresentation]”,在“替换为”框中留空。
(4)点击“全部替换”按钮,将所有幻灯片末尾的“[EndOfPresentation]”替换为空。
(5)再次按“F5”键,即可实现重复播放。
二、PPT自动循环播放设置方法
1. 使用“自动播放”功能
(1)打开PPT文件,点击“幻灯片放映”选项卡。
(2)在“设置放映方式”组中,点击“自定义放映”。
(3)在弹出的“自定义放映”对话框中,选择要自动播放的幻灯片。
(4)点击“确定”按钮,返回“设置放映方式”对话框。
(5)勾选“放映时不加旁白”和“循环放映,按Esc键终止”选项。
(6)点击“确定”按钮,完成设置。
2. 使用VBA宏
(1)打开PPT文件,按“Alt+F11”键进入VBA编辑器。
(2)在“插入”菜单中选择“模块”,在打开的模块窗口中输入以下代码:
```
Sub AutoPlay()
Dim sld As Slide
For Each sld In ThisPresentation.Slides
sld.View.SlideShowTransition.EntryEffect = msoShowEffectFade
sld.View.SlideShowTransition.Speed = msoSlideShowTransitionSpeedMedium
sld.View.SlideShowTransition.Duration = 1
sld.View.SlideShowTransition.SoundEffect = msoSoundEffectNone
Next sld
ThisPresentation.Slides(1).View.SlideShowTransition.StartShow
End Sub
```
(3)关闭VBA编辑器,返回PPT界面。
(4)按“Alt+F8”键,在弹出的“宏”对话框中,选择“AutoPlay”宏。
(5)点击“运行”按钮,即可实现自动循环播放。
三、相关问答
1. 问题:PPT重复播放设置后,为什么按Esc键不能退出?
答案:可能是因为您在设置放映方式时,没有勾选“放映时不加旁白”选项。请重新设置,确保勾选该选项。
2. 问题:如何设置PPT自动循环播放的时间间隔?
答案:在VBA宏中,可以通过修改`sld.View.SlideShowTransition.Duration`变量的值来设置时间间隔。例如,将`Duration = 2`设置为2秒。
3. 问题:PPT自动循环播放时,如何添加背景音乐?
答案:在VBA宏中,可以通过添加以下代码来实现:
```
ThisPresentation.Slides(1).View.SlideShowTransition.SoundEffect = msoSoundEffectSystemSound
ThisPresentation.Slides(1).View.SlideShowTransition.SoundEffectPath = "C:\path\to\your\music.mp3"
```
将`SoundEffectPath`变量的值修改为您要添加的背景音乐路径。
4. 问题:如何设置PPT自动循环播放的幻灯片顺序?
答案:在自定义放映中,选择要自动播放的幻灯片即可。您可以根据需要调整幻灯片的播放顺序。
通过以上方法,您可以根据实际需求设置PPT的重复播放和自动循环播放功能。希望本文对您有所帮助。